Do I really need to sterilise cutlery to play with?

Hi all,

DS is only 19 weeks old so way too little to start weaning yet. I'm keen to go down the BLW route and he has started to take a real interest in DH and I eating. As such, we've started sitting him in his high chair at mealtimes and he seems to really enjoy watching us eat. I was going to give him a wee plastic spoon or something to play with but the HV told me I need to sterilise cutlery/plates etc. This seemed a bit excessive, given I don't sterilise teethers or things like the remote control, which he rams in his chops with glee if we're daft enough to leave it within reach. I'd also wondered about giving him a cup with a tiny bit of cooled boiled water in it as he keeps swiping for glasses - he is EBF so tell me off now if that's a bad idea!

no - you don't need to sterilise. As you say, what's the point considering the other stuff they shove in their mouths??

lilham · 30/09/2011 12:13

The only reason you sterilize bottles is because milk is hard to clean from the teats and spout. You want to kill bacteria from old mouldy milk.
